Household Income in Sun Green ONS 2023

The average total household income in Sun Green is approximately £45,642 a year before tax, 17%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£33,926.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Sun Green ONS 2025

There are approximately 897 active businesses based in Sun Green, around 33 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 89%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 10 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Sun Green

Of the 11,901 households in and around Sun Green, 60% are owned, 23% are socially rented and 17% are privately rented. Home ownership here is lower than the England and Wales average of 63%.

Owned 60% Social rented 23% Private rented 17%

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Sun Green.
